In recent years a predominant strategy for setting sound quality (SQ) requirements has been the sensory correlation approach (also called sensory evaluation or sensory science). Some users of this approach have reported their progress in numerous papers. Other SQ practitioners have made presentations on specific topics that show the linkage to music and musical notation. These specific links point to an alternative general strategy - “the Music Analogy for Sound Quality.” This paper begins by comparing the general methods of the music analogy and sensory correlation. Some major differences will be identified and implications discussed. Some existing specific tools for the music analogy will be identified as well as some gaps that need to be filled. Finally, reasons will be presented concerning why the music analogy should be considered when developing sound quality requirements.
